HEALTH - A state of complete physical, mental, and social well-being and not merely the absence of disease or infirmity.

HEALTH RECORD: All documents and recorded information relating to the clinical management of the patient.

HEMANGIOMA - A benign tumor consisting of a mass of blood vessels.

HEMATOMA - A blood clot.

HEMIANOPIA - Loss of vision of one-half of the visual field.

HEMIPLEGIA - Paralysis of one side of the body.

HEMORRHAGE - Bleeding due to the escape of blood from a blood vessel.

HERNIATED DISC ? Extrusion of part of the softer nucleus pulposus material of the disc by way of defects in the firmer, outer annulus fibrosis portion of the disc. If greatly herniated, the material can compress the spinal cord or nerves in or exiting the spinal canal.

HOMEOPATHY - A therapeutic system developed by Samuel Hahnemann that uses extremely dilute substances to trigger a person?s innate capacity to heal, based on the law of similars, the observation that certain substances can produce in healthy people the same symptoms they cure in the sick. The first observation was that the symptoms of an illness were identical to the symptoms experienced by a healthy individual who had been given a drug which could treat that illness.

HORMONE - A chemical substance formed in one gland or part of the body and carried by the blood to another organ, which it stimulates to functional activity.

HYDROXYAPATITE (HA) - The lattice-like structure of bone composed of calcium and phosphorous crystals which deposits on collagen to provide the rigid structure of bone.

HYPERACUSIS - Abnormal acuteness of hearing or auditory sensation.

HYPERESTHESIA - Excessive sensibility to touch, pain, or other stimuli.

HYPERTENSION - High blood pressure.

HYPOTHALAMUS - A collection of specialized nerve cells at the base of the brain which control the anterior and posterior pituitary secretions and is involved in other basic regulatory functions, such as temperature control and attention.
